Output e32db904dca9266079761a9348fd144829b325a86b38498b5f26b8d6fe7c8017:0

value
2332010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0c0bfbb301cf33f43124fe04322f90576d9c3f OP_EQUAL
address
3MqogxwQePuJ9Mfu3ErEovpfjGYVtGUXc3
transaction
e32db904dca9266079761a9348fd144829b325a86b38498b5f26b8d6fe7c8017
spent
true